HC Deb 28 October 1996 vol 284 cc54-5W
Mr. Tipping

To ask the Minister of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food what was(a) the number of agricultural holdings and (b) the hectarage of agricultural land in each county in England in (i) 1995 and (ii) 1996. [775]

Mr. Boswell

The information requested for 1995 is set out in the table. Equivalent information is not yet available for 1996.

Number of holdings1 Area2 ha
Avon 2,032 81,383
Bedfordshire 1,174 89,285
Berkshire 842 71,456
Buckinghamshire 1,853 123,870
Cambridgeshire 3,283 281,529
Cheshire 4,180 166,038
Cleveland 429 27,616
Cornwall 6,679 276,045
Cumbria 6,270 461,830
Derbyshire 3,837 185,206
Devon 11,513 521,705
Dorset 2,949 196,627
Durham 2,169 156,081
Essex 3,554 263,693
Gloucestershire 3,389 204,613
Greater London 431 13,819
Greater Manchester 1,454 40,215
Hampshire 2,981 226,024
Hereford and Worcester 6,531 307,935
Hertfordshire 1,313 103,265
Humberside 3,391 284,561
Isle of Wight 487 25,859
Kent 4,078 246,643
Lancashire 5,307 215,116
Leicestershire 2,888 194,120
Lincolnshire 5,530 51 9,807
Merseyside 454 19,458
Norfolk 4,949 428,769
Northamptonshire 2,014 184,214
Northumberland 2,335 382,370
Nottinghamshire 1,987 149,672
Oxfordshire 2,077 203,110
Shropshire 4,728 283,205
Somerset 5,794 272,248
Staffordshire 4,640 195,244
Suffolk 3,443 304,483
Surrey 1,696 65,345
East Sussex 2,227 112,718
West Sussex 2,225 123,331
Tyne and Wear 271 13,485
Warwickshire 2,403 153,476
West Midlands 459 15,014
Wiltshire 3,062 266,171
North Yorkshire 8,420 628,643
South Yorkshire 1,395 84,259
West Yorkshire 2,989 97,122
1Main holdings only (account for some 99 per cent. of agricultural land).
2Exluding common rought grazing.
